From owner-svn-src-all@freebsd.org Tue Apr 30 15:24:38 2019 Return-Path: Delivered-To: svn-src-all@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 8C3931595659 for ; Tue, 30 Apr 2019 15:24:38 +0000 (UTC) (envelope-from wlosh@bsdimp.com) Received: from mail-qt1-x832.google.com (mail-qt1-x832.google.com [IPv6:2607:f8b0:4864:20::832]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its) server-signature RSA-PSS (4096 bits) client-signature RSA-PSS (2048 bits) client-digest SHA256) (Client CN "smtp.gmail.com", Issuer "GTS CA 1O1"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 290EA771BB for ; Tue, 30 Apr 2019 15:24:38 +0000 (UTC) (envelope-from wlosh@bsdimp.com) Received: by mail-qt1-x832.google.com with SMTP id d13so16573201qth.5 for ; Tue, 30 Apr 2019 08:24:38 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=bsdimp-com.20150623.gappssmtp.com; s=20150623;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=Yl2EMt15elu4oxf2JGGS6wqU0GrIaki3oQhxCPfnaow=; b=MtPKNmISxOGeOcuDPlil+B6yJsGxfVkO8FPRorYRJdzbPpyg3Xp/fTmlO4mhotBvr4 NCQeVBB/gLXghn4ocxuiaIR1WUm2MdV1ClEAmfGJcZT5w4E6L4NtG1Qk4cF/8PxE/MM5 sF0Vdkw1Kr65wD3XrUeRjr2Zwq99z4zbyVZ20f5GlPyWOeRyTDvbIISZjzRYxTvquXDn NmaC0KajhMnUiQdLNaa3NmQtdO1VhrlXC/m+XtXjGoSfYMnS4qMk+vmuX7grIxUoHbws KyqM9jd18XHBSbr9IiZTy6GLB2AZBEVL31W1jWrt38JgDsWZ/SIh4OtC19Gqi/crDeKN YNKg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=Yl2EMt15elu4oxf2JGGS6wqU0GrIaki3oQhxCPfnaow=; b=lqSd78DwoPlqxE1ZZS+XDPoz5CDmKW9nAWmEcvzl0jVIx9wrXvtX1LrlmW/xRWlYWf repkaY1NoPr14Wqd+ZHdMQR/B/1EXmCvgLcD12N+jqT2km8OncJGo89iXljHoNnRU39g hqujYrSkjmMRmtOFs4zYK9n7C2kpyTMltYAX3WUJvBi8gU9Gme+B7bLzWzPz0mrCPwqk xmKcB9hkcRKM7gDpMd/UuFyiYHxBEl7sjbBBBwax3Hui9rNW33bYHcaAYRpLLmOQOz6B WVdyx4cxbK41opMDp54uSmT+zOymaspq3XaSEANsREQmA576fnP2aI1uKGD1wmLTOZPQ NLsA== X-Gm-Message-State: APjAAAUWPyvKWc/wrX+n6nAxTC0bfkaX54pFBEMhPGEDc4BaS9h1flSH Bl+hwDVbeh4l652UQ1UaLWVjz97084jssKo4Vk3v7w== X-Google-Smtp-Source: APXvYqwJvBMy+IdPrcmd61rB/pbSY8DYqM1V/8kxT8czKKEens8rgG93UxxQnkxzputbAzJCYukco++7lceOyVWEXVg= X-Received: by 2002:ac8:28d0:: with SMTP id j16mr56190135qtj.15.1556637877357; Tue, 30 Apr 2019 08:24:37 -0700 (PDT) MIME-Version: 1.0 References: <201904301041.x3UAfLvj054368@repo.freebsd.org> <8f360678-2df1-fe7b-cb83-f47923534826@freebsd.org> <2f77d9f2-833d-f614-e193-a369086c01cf@selasky.org> In-Reply-To: <2f77d9f2-833d-f614-e193-a369086c01cf@selasky.org> From: Warner Losh Date: Tue, 30 Apr 2019 09:24:25 -0600 Message-ID: Subject: Re: svn commit: r346958 - head/sys/compat/linuxkpi/common/src To: Hans Petter Selasky Cc: Niclas Zeising , src-committers , svn-src-all , svn-src-head X-Rspamd-Queue-Id: 290EA771BB X-Spamd-Bar: ------ Authentication-Results: mx1.freebsd.org X-Spamd-Result: default: False [-6.99 / 15.00]; NEURAL_HAM_MEDIUM(-1.00)[-1.000,0]; NEURAL_HAM_SHORT(-0.99)[-0.990,0]; NEURAL_HAM_LONG(-1.00)[-1.000,0]; REPLY(-4.00)[] Content-Type: text/plain; charset="UTF-8" X-Content-Filtered-By: Mailman/MimeDel 2.1.29 X-BeenThere: svn-src-all@freebsd.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"SVN commit messages for the entire src tree \(except for " user" and " projects" \)"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 30 Apr 2019 15:24:38 -0000 On Tue, Apr 30, 2019 at 9:17 AM Hans Petter Selasky wrote: > On 4/30/19 3:10 PM, Niclas Zeising wrote: > > On 2019-04-30 12:41, Hans Petter Selasky wrote: > >> Author: hselasky > >> Date: Tue Apr 30 10:41:20 2019 > >> New Revision: 346958 > >> URL: https://svnweb.freebsd.org/changeset/base/346958 > >> > >> Log: > >> Reduce the number of mutexes after r346645 in the LinuxKPI. > >> Make function macro wrappers for locking and unlocking to ease > >> readability. > >> No functional change. > >> Discussed with: kib@, tychon@ and zeising@ > > > > I was not part of any discussion regarding this. If this is related to > > https://reviews.freebsd.org/D20097 I explicitly asked you on gitter to > > hold of for a bit, while we try to figure out why we are seeing > > regressions in graphics with the latest dmar changes. > > > > Can you please revert this since it colludes the dmar graphics issue, > > and it makes the suggested patch not apply cleanly, which makes it > > harder to get people to help test. > > Thank you! > > Regards > > In response to your request I've collected fixes for all the known > LinuxKPI+DMA issues at: > https://reviews.freebsd.org/D20097 > > It is based on top of the latest -current. > Hopefully this will solve the problem. Do you have any idea of when we might see resolution of this issue? I'd like to see it fixed by Friday either with fixes or a revert. Do you think that's a reasonable time frame? If not, what do you think a reasonable time frame will be? I know we have a number of unknowns to factor in, so my queries are based on our best guesses. Warner